The true hot summertime arrived at the last weeks of August. People and and animals went to the shadows of the trees as well, to find a little bit colder place and to spend as less time under the shining Sun as possible. It looked as if the water was boiling thanks to the fishes, who came up from the deeper - less oxygen - water layers to the upper, warmer water just below the surface. The just want some fresh air.


My first pike was caught with feeder rod.


In these times, it is almost impossible to catch some nice carp on a quick fishing (to be honest, I caught only few bigger fish during dogday), if we want to be successful, we should give a try at dawn or at dusk, when the air is coldish and the fish are ready to eat. Let’s be honest, many many times, we can’t choose the right weather. But just because of this, should we give up and wait until the conditions will be perfect? Of course not! We have other possibilities than catching carp, let’s fishing for silverfish!

Breams and roaches can be caught easily in these times as well. Let’s find a nice tree with great shade on the waterfront and the fishing can be continue. I just started on this way on a beautiful, shiny day of our holiday, to catch some nice fish from our hotel’s lake.


Mixed groundbait, but for pikes?

The favorite bait of the day was three pinkies.


It was important from the first time, to choose the best, easiest equipment for the holiday. I took my favorite fishing line, the Competition Feeder with me of course. I choose one of my other favorite reel, the Power Match. The size of the reel was 40. It is fast and durable, really good choice for any light coarse fishing technique (it was designed to be a mid level float fishing reel with good price originally, but I prefer to use it for feeder fishing as well).

The groundbait was a little bit difficult, you are curious maybe why? I have only the Carp Expert Golden Carp in my bag. And this is not the ideal bait for silverfish, or is it? To be honest, I accidentally left home all the baits for bream. I tried to mix the ground bait with less water to keep it dry. My theory was that on this was the bait will open at the upper level of the water.

I always want to make sure that my theory is working or not. At his time, I want to make sure that I cant catch carp thanks to the warm weather. I made a quick bailing-in with some cast at the middle of the lake. I used one single piece Carp Expert Roach-bream named pellet. I but pinkies to the picker's small hook.

The minutes were going and going. Once upon a time I decided to change the bait and I started to reel up the line. After some seconds, it became hard to reel, I felt that its a fish, roach maybe I think. In 15 yards to the waterfront, I noticed that the body of my roach is too long and slim. Furthermore it had too big tooths, so it cant be a roach, it was a pike.

From that time, I was very careful, my hook was size 16, the hooklenght was 0.12 milimeters. Fortunately the hook was caught at the edge of its jaw. There was no chance to bite the line. The brake was not worked so hard, the rod took almost all the movements of the fish. At last I was able to cath it, and hold it in my hands. I had no scale, but based on the tape measure it was 46 centimeter long. Hence it won the "Biggest Pike in my life – with feeder -!" title!

I took some nice picture, then I put it back to the water. I worming my hook and cast it next to the other one bailing-in, which was placed closer to the waterfront. The only I can say that I did not caught any carp on that day, but more silverfish! The lake has some beautiful bream!

The ground bait for carp worked well in catching silverfish. I caught the mid size fishes one by one. The peace of the lake was deep and calming. I looks I was the only guy around the water.
